Las Vegas: Aladdin remade as Planet Hollywood Resort & Casino

Want to stay somewhere you've never been?

By Jane Engle, Los Angeles Times Staff Writer
12:20 PM PDT, April 11, 2007

What's new: This 2,600-room Strip hotel on April 17, 2007 will be renamed Planet Hollywood Resort & Casino and open a 1,565-seat showroom featuring the musical "Stomp Out Loud." A $200-million-plus makeover has also added a crystal-bedecked lobby, lounges, a poker room, a 24-hour coffee shop and more. Room renovations are ongoing. The style is "hip retro," a spokeswoman said.

Info: Aladdin Resort & Casino, 3667 Las Vegas Blvd. S., Las Vegas, NV 89109; (877) 333-9474, www.planethollywoodresort.com. Rack rates from $159 a night midweek, $199 on the weekend.
